Agriculture was the mainstay of the economy of Great Zimbabwe. How far true is this assertion?

The view that agriculture was the mainstay of the economy of Great Zimbabwe does not carry momentum. While on one hand, Great Zimbabwe’s economy featured agriculture, that is, the growing of crops and rearing of livestock, on the other hand, it also was largely characterizing of trade, hunting, mining, iron smelting, tribute payment and raiding.…

The scramble and partition for Southern Africa

The scramble and partition for Southern Africameans the competition to obtain territories. By 1900 the whole of Southern Africa was under colonial rule. Colonies belonging to one power became empire.
